# Gemma Roleplay v2 LoRA adapter

This is the PEFT adapter for [Gemma Roleplay v2](https://huggingface.co/text-generator/llmtrain),
trained from [google/gemma-4-E4B-it](https://huggingface.co/google/gemma-4-E4B-it)
with QLoRA SFT. It is intended for fictional consenting-adult roleplay and
creative chat. See the parent model card for usage, limitations, and the live
hosted inference endpoint.

## Quick start

```python
from transformers import AutoModelForCausalLM, AutoTokenizer
from peft import PeftModel

base = "google/gemma-4-E4B-it"
tokenizer = AutoTokenizer.from_pretrained(base)
model = AutoModelForCausalLM.from_pretrained(base, torch_dtype="auto", device_map="auto")
model = PeftModel.from_pretrained(model, "text-generator/llmtrain", subfolder="adapter")
inputs = tokenizer.apply_chat_template(
    [{"role": "user", "content": "Write a short scene in a haunted hotel."}],
    add_generation_prompt=True, return_tensors="pt",
).to(model.device)
output = model.generate(inputs, max_new_tokens=128, do_sample=True, temperature=0.85)
print(tokenizer.decode(output[0, inputs.shape[-1]:], skip_special_tokens=True))
```
